About Duke University, Department of Biomedical Engineering
The Department of Biomedical Engineering (BME) at Duke University Pratt School of Engineering. consistently rank among the very top undergraduate and graduate programs in the field. Research in the department encompasses with bioelectric engineering, biomaterials, biomedical imaging and biophotonics, biomechanics and mechanotransduction, immune engineering, neural engineering, tissue engineering, synthetic biology, and drug and gene delivery. Faculty, postdocs, and students actively translate basic research advances into useful devices or therapies that impact patient care.
